Job Summary

We are seeking a highly strategic and hands‑on Graphic Designer – Events to own the end‑to‑end creative vision for large‑scale conferences, trade shows, and internal events. This role is responsible for translating business goals and brand narratives into immersive, high‑impact experiences across scenic environments, activations, and integrated digital and physical collateral. This individual will bridge concept and execution by designing bold 3D environments and shaping cohesive content ecosystems that bring our value proposition to life across every touchpoint.

Role Description Creative Strategy & Experience Design
  • Lead the creative vision for events by developing compelling, cohesive experiences aligned to brand, messaging, and business objectives.
  • Translate strategic narratives and value propositions into immersive spatial and content‑driven experiences.
  • Define end‑to‑end experience frameworks, including environments, activations, and supporting collateral.
  • Ensure consistency and cohesion across physical, digital, and hybrid touchpoints.
Experiential & Environmental Design
  • Concept and design large‑scale scenic buildouts, booths, stages, and branded environments.
  • Develop 3D renderings and visualizations to communicate design intent and achieve stakeholder alignment.
  • Design pop‑up activations and modular environments adaptable across event types and scales.
Content & Collateral Ecosystem
  • Recommend and define comprehensive event content packages, including signage systems, digital displays, print collateral, and interactive touchpoints.
  • Ensure all creative outputs align with a unified narrative and attendee journey.
  • Partner with copywriters, designers, and motion/video teams to execute creative concepts.
Cross‑Functional Collaboration
  • Work closely with internal stakeholders to align on objectives and execution.
  • Collaborate with internal creative teams to guide concept development and production.
  • Liaise with external vendors, fabricators, and experiential partners to ensure quality execution.
Production Oversight
  • Guide projects from concept through execution, maintaining design integrity.
  • Review and approve creative outputs, including builds, signage, and digital assets.
  • Operate within production constraints, timelines, and budgets.
Skills and Experience
  • Strong expertise in experiential design and event environments (conferences, trade shows, and brand activations).
  • Advanced 3D design and rendering skills (e.g., Sketch Up, Cinema 4D, Blender, or similar).
  • Proficiency in print and digital production, with knowledge of materials, fabrication, and display systems.
  • Ability to think holistically across spatial design, content, and storytelling.
  • Strong conceptual and strategic thinking abilities.
  • Ability to connect brand narratives to physical and digital experiences.
  • Experience developing integrated creative systems beyond standalone deliverables.
  • Strong communication skills with the ability to clearly articulate creative vision.
  • Ability to collaborate cross‑functionally with creative and non‑creative stakeholders.
  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ple stakeholders, vendors, and competing priorities.
Other Requirements
  • Bachelor’s degree in Graphic Design, Visual Communications, Fine Arts, or a related field, or equivalent practical experience.
  • Experience in an in‑house brand or creative team and/or agency environment.
  • Portfolio demonstrating experiential design work, including scenic design, activations, and integrated campaigns.
  • Familiarity with event technology such as LED walls, interactive installations, and AR/VR.
  • Experience supporting global event programs or scaling environments across regions.
  • On‑site event experience overseeing installation and execution.
